Gabriella, a 21-year-old new client, just scheduled a well visit for next week. Her English is limited. Which of the following interventions should the nurse make before and during the office visit to put Gabriella at ease and provide excellent care? (Select all that apply.)
A) Arrange to have an interpreter present
B) Have the patient undress before the health history interview
C) Sit at eye level and face the patient
D) Include the patient's boyfriend in the health history interview
E) Begin the interview with some casual conversation

A, C, E

Appropriate topics to include in a patient's social history include which of the following? (Select all that apply.)
A) Occupation
B) Income level
C) Diet
D) Exercise
E) Sexual history

A, C, D, E
3
Appropriate topics to include in a patient's medical history include which of the following? (Select all that apply.)
A) Medications
B) Views on abortion
C) Allergies
D) Surgeries
E) Immunizations

A, C, D, E
